Some progressed beds are geared up with columns which help tilt the bed to 1530 levels on each side. Such tilting can help prevent pressure abscess for the person, and assist caretakers to do their day-to-day jobs with less of a risk of back injuries. Hospital Beds For Home Use. Wheels make it possible for simple movement of the bed, either within parts of the facility in which they lie, or within the areaWheels are lockable. For safety and security, wheels can be locked when moving the person in or out of the bed. A hospital bed can cost over US$ 1000.00; generally with various prices associated with totally hand-operated features, 2-motor features and fully electrical 3-motor functions (entire bed fluctuating). Various other expenses are related to bariatric heavy duty versions that additionally use extra width.

Medicare will certainly additionally help to cover the expense of some bed accessories, which may include trapeze bars, bed mattress covers that are planned to avoid bedsores, and bedside rails. As opposed to buy a home health center bed right out, one can also lease a health center bed and still receive financial help from Medicare.
Rumored Buzz on Hospital Beds For Home Use

It's vital to keep in mind, Medicare will certainly not cover the cost of complete electric beds. One can pay the difference out-of-pocket in between a manual-lift bed and a completely electric one. Additionally, Medicare only covers a fundamental bed, implying a shape extremely similar to a twin bed, however not identical.

The complying with examples presume the tax obligation filer has nothing else medical expenditures for the year. The tax filer can deduct the price of the bed that is over 10% of their modified gross revenue. If component of the bed was covered by insurance policy, the tax obligation filer would only be able to subtract the part that was paid out-of-pocket.
10% of $20,000 is $2,000. She acquired a healthcare facility bed for $3,000 out-of-pocket. Consequently, she can deduct $1,000 from her federal tax obligations. Example: John has an adjusted gross income in the amount of $15,000. Medicare selected up $2,400 of a $3,000 bed, leaving John $600 to pay (the 20% co-payment).

The rate of a semi-electric bed normally starts at around $1,000. The length of a common hospital bed from the top of the bed to the base of the bed is 38" size by 84" size, with the rest surface being 36" size by 80" long.
There are likewise full size hospital beds, which are 54" wide by 80" long, queen dimension beds that are 60" broad by 80" long, and economy size beds that are 76" vast by 80" long. Additionally, there are also bariatric beds that come in a bigger size of 48".
Home medical facility beds require sheets that are especially made for this kind of bed. This is due to the fact that a normal hospital bed is the size of a twin bed in width, yet is longer in size. One need to anticipate to pay roughly $50 for a collection of sheets for a common home healthcare facility bed.
